Compatibility

Information on Celeron G5900 and Atom x7433RE compatibility with other computer components: motherboard (look for socket type), power supply unit (look for power consumption) etc. Useful when planning a future computer configuration or upgrading an existing one. Note that power consumption of some processors can well exceed their nominal TDP, even without overclocking. Some can even double their declared thermals given that the motherboard allows to tune the CPU power parameters.

Pros & cons summary


Recency 30 April 2020 8 April 2024
Physical cores 2 4
Threads 2 4
Chip lithography 14 nm 10 nm
Power consumption (TDP) 58 Watt 9 Watt

Atom x7433RE has an age advantage of 3 years, 100% more physical cores and 100% more threads, a 40% more advanced lithography process, and 544.4% lower power consumption.

We couldn't decide between Celeron G5900 and Atom x7433RE. We've got no test results to judge.

Note that Celeron G5900 is a desktop processor while Atom x7433RE is a notebook one.
